scientific tests in rodents working with radiolabelled dopamine in synaptosomes uncovered that THC brought about amplified dopamine synthesis31 and release24 (Fig. two). On the other hand, the effects on dopamine uptake yielded conflicting effects, with proof of both of those increases32 and dose-dependent decreases24. Subsequently biphasic and triphasic effects of THC ended up learned, whereby lower doses of THC created improves during the conversion of tyrosine to dopamine, but large doses of THC resulted in reduced dopamine synthesis33.

That prescription drugs like antidepressants and antipsychotics are increasingly being prescribed for extended and for a longer period durations indicates that a lot of people might obtain it challenging, both for Actual physical or psychological causes, to stop medication the moment it truly is began (Moore et al. 2009; Prah et al. 2012). This is certainly of he said specific issue supplied the critical adverse consequences connected to lengthy-expression use of drugs like antipsychotics, which consist of cardiac troubles, metabolic dysfunction, and neurological hurt including tardive dyskinesia (Newcomer & Haupt 2006; Ray et al. 2009; Tarsy et al. 2011).
